淘汰redis集群中的机器(redis集群去掉机器)

2023-05-06 05:32:08 集群 机器 去掉

在现代网络环境中,Redis集群可以帮助组织保存和管理大量的数据,并能够以高效且可靠的方式处理各种请求。然而,当把数据存储在多个机器上时,必须对该集群中的机器进行管理,以确保它们能够工作在最优的状态,以满足业务需求。本文将介绍演示如何淘汰redis集群中的机器。

要从集群中淘汰机器,必须先暂停Redis服务,可以使用以下命令:

“`shell

# 对每个停止redis的节点执行

$ service redis stop


之后,需要确保集群中的任何剩余机器都将新节点从队列中删除。使用命令如下:

```shell
# 队列里的每一个节点执行
$ redis-cli cluster forget

当淘汰完机器后,可以调整剩余机器的状态使其变成更高效的模式(如 slave -> master)。可以使用下面的命令来查看集群中的节点:

“`shell

$ redis-cli cluster nodes


经过上述步骤,可以找出一个合适的源节点,然后可以在目标节点上使用以下命令将其设定为源节点的从节点:

```shell
# 在目标节点上运行
$ redis-cli cluster replicate

使用以下命令来添加节点并调整它的主从关系:

“`shell

$ redis-cli cluster add-node –slave


以上就是淘汰redis集群中的机器的步骤,让我们尝试一下来提升工作效率,提供给用户更好的服务。

相关文章